const defaultLocale = { future: 'in %s', past: '%s ago', s: 'a few seconds', m: 'a minute', mm: '%d minutes', h: 'an hour', hh: '%d hours', d: 'a day', dd: '%d days', M: 'a month', MM: '%d months', y: 'a year', yy: '%d years', }; const locales = { en: defaultLocale, 'en-US': defaultLocale, 'en-GB': defaultLocale, de: { future: 'in %s', past: 'vor %s', s: 'ein paar Sekunden', m: 'eine Minute', mm: '%d Minuten', h: 'eine Stunde', hh: '%d Stunden', d: 'ein Tag', dd: '%d Tage', M: 'ein Monat', MM: '%d Monate', y: 'ein Jahr', yy: '%d Jahre', }, 'de-DE': { future: 'in %s', past: 'vor %s', s: 'ein paar Sekunden', m: 'eine Minute', mm: '%d Minuten', h: 'eine Stunde', hh: '%d Stunden', d: 'ein Tag', dd: '%d Tage', M: 'ein Monat', MM: '%d Monate', y: 'ein Jahr', yy: '%d Jahre', }, tr: { future: '%s içinde', past: '%s önce', s: 'birkaç saniye', m: 'bir dakika', mm: '%d dakika', h: 'bir saat', hh: '%d saat', d: 'bir gün', dd: '%d gün', M: 'bir ay', MM: '%d ay', y: 'bir yıl', yy: '%d yıl', }, 'tr-TR': { future: '%s içinde', past: '%s önce', s: 'birkaç saniye', m: 'bir dakika', mm: '%d dakika', h: 'bir saat', hh: '%d saat', d: 'bir gün', dd: '%d gün', M: 'bir ay', MM: '%d ay', y: 'bir yıl', yy: '%d yıl', }, ja: { future: '%s後', past: '%s前', s: '数秒', m: '1分', mm: '%d分', h: '1時間', hh: '%d時間', d: '1日', dd: '%d日', M: '1ヶ月', MM: '%dヶ月', y: '1年', yy: '%d年', }, 'ja-JP': { future: '%s後', past: '%s前', s: '数秒', m: '1分', mm: '%d分', h: '1時間', hh: '%d時間', d: '1日', dd: '%d日', M: '1ヶ月', MM: '%dヶ月', y: '1年', yy: '%d年', }, }; class RelativeTimeCalculator { constructor(locale = 'en') { this.locale = locales[locale] || locales[locale.split('-')[0]] || defaultLocale; } format(diff, withoutSuffix = false) { const abs = Math.abs(diff); const seconds = Math.round(abs / 1000); const minutes = Math.round(seconds / 60); const hours = Math.round(minutes / 60); const days = Math.round(hours / 24); const months = Math.round(days / 30.436875); const years = Math.round(days / 365.25); let result; if (seconds < 45) { result = this.locale.s; } else if (seconds < 90) { result = this.locale.m; } else if (minutes < 45) { result = this.locale.mm.replace('%d', minutes.toString()); } else if (minutes < 90) { result = this.locale.h; } else if (hours < 22) { result = this.locale.hh.replace('%d', hours.toString()); } else if (hours < 36) { result = this.locale.d; } else if (days < 26) { result = this.locale.dd.replace('%d', days.toString()); } else if (days < 46) { result = this.locale.M; } else if (days < 320) { result = this.locale.MM.replace('%d', months.toString()); } else if (days < 548) { result = this.locale.y; } else { result = this.locale.yy.replace('%d', years.toString()); } if (withoutSuffix) { return result; } const template = diff > 0 ? this.locale.future : this.locale.past; return template.replace('%s', result); } formatNative(diff, locale = 'en', options = {}) { if (typeof Intl !== 'undefined' && Intl.RelativeTimeFormat) { const rtf = new Intl.RelativeTimeFormat(locale, { numeric: options.numeric || 'auto', style: options.style || 'long', }); const abs = Math.abs(diff); const seconds = abs / 1000; const minutes = seconds / 60; const hours = minutes / 60; const days = hours / 24; const weeks = days / 7; const months = days / 30.436875; const years = days / 365.25; const sign = diff > 0 ? 1 : -1; if (years >= 1) { return rtf.format(sign * Math.round(years), 'year'); } if (months >= 1) { return rtf.format(sign * Math.round(months), 'month'); } if (weeks >= 1) { return rtf.format(sign * Math.round(weeks), 'week'); } if (days >= 1) { return rtf.format(sign * Math.round(days), 'day'); } if (hours >= 1) { return rtf.format(sign * Math.round(hours), 'hour'); } if (minutes >= 1) { return rtf.format(sign * Math.round(minutes), 'minute'); } return rtf.format(sign * Math.round(seconds), 'second'); } return this.format(diff); } } const relativeTimePlugin = { name: 'relativeTime', install(kairos) { kairos.extend({ fromNow(withoutSuffix = false) { const now = Date.now(); const thisTime = this.valueOf(); const diff = thisTime - now; const calculator = new RelativeTimeCalculator(); return calculator.format(diff, withoutSuffix); }, from(other, withoutSuffix = false) { const thisTime = this.valueOf(); const otherTime = other.valueOf(); const diff = thisTime - otherTime; const calculator = new RelativeTimeCalculator(); return calculator.format(diff, withoutSuffix); }, toNow(withoutSuffix = false) { const now = Date.now(); const thisTime = this.valueOf(); const diff = now - thisTime; const calculator = new RelativeTimeCalculator(); return calculator.format(diff, withoutSuffix); }, to(other, withoutSuffix = false) { const thisTime = this.valueOf(); const otherTime = other.valueOf(); const diff = otherTime - thisTime; const calculator = new RelativeTimeCalculator(); return calculator.format(diff, withoutSuffix); }, humanize(withSuffix = false) { const calculator = new RelativeTimeCalculator(); const value = this.valueOf(); return calculator.format(value, !withSuffix); }, fromNowNative(locale = 'en', options) { const now = Date.now(); const thisTime = this.valueOf(); const diff = thisTime - now; const calculator = new RelativeTimeCalculator(); return calculator.formatNative(diff, locale, options); }, toNowNative(locale = 'en', options) { const now = Date.now(); const thisTime = this.valueOf(); const diff = now - thisTime; const calculator = new RelativeTimeCalculator(); return calculator.formatNative(diff, locale, options); }, }); kairos.addStatic({ relativeTime: { registerLocale(name, locale) { locales[name] = locale; }, getLocale(name) { return locales[name]; }, calculator(locale) { return new RelativeTimeCalculator(locale); }, }, }); }, }; export default relativeTimePlugin; export { RelativeTimeCalculator }; //# sourceMappingURL=relative-time.js.map
